  • Dallas Colin Coyle



    Dallas Coyle is an American musician. He's one of the founding members of the critically acclaimed, world renowned metal band God Forbid from New Jersey. Since 1997, Dallas helped shaped the extreme metal music scene by touring the world ten times over, creating five records of pure musicianship, and selling over 300,000 records. In April of 2009, after the release of "Earthsblood", God Forbid's most critically acclaimed album, Dallas departed ways with his band to embark on his own musical journey.

    Since going off on his own, Dallas has scored short films, written various songs for his first solo project Soul At War (SAW) and even produced, scored and acted in the web TV show Polyester Dreams. Genetic is his latest solo project, available here for preview and purchase.

    Andrew Harrison



    Andrew Harrison is a writer and producer. In 2007, Andrew was hired to write and star in a comedic talk show called Street Talk for Jim Cramer’s financial news web site, TheStreet.com. After that, he found a love for the medium and wrote, directed and produced his own comedic web series called Polyester Dreams, about a manic-depressive prog rock radio DJ. The show won the Web Streaming category at the SkyFest Film Festival and it was called “humorous and all-out ridiculously entertaining” by SPIN.

    Through ProMotion Pictures, Andrew has produced branded online video content for Heineken, Johnnie Walker, Cisco and Ogilvy & Mather.

    For the past three years, Andrew has hosted Plastic Tales from the Marshmallow Dimension, a retro rock radio show syndicated in New York and Paris. His graphic novel Golgotha was published by 215 Ink. Andrew currently works for the online video company Ooyala.

    Shay Revolver



    Shay Revolver is an independent filmmaker whose recent projects include The Panic Pixie Project where she completed 28 short films in 28 days. Her shorts have been seen at NYUFF, RESFest, Slamdunk and she has won several Pioneer Theater Short Film Slams. In addition to Beg Borrow Steal, Shay is also working on a feature film and the second installment of The Panic Pixie Project through her Manic Pixie Pictures production company.
